Soccer Preview: Fairless vs. Northwest
Fairless hasn't had much luck against Northwest recently, but that could start to change on Wednesday. The Fairless Falcons will be playing at home against the Northwest Indians at 6:00 p.m. Neither squad made it on the board the last time they hit the pitch, so they've probably got a bit of extra motivation.
Fairless is headed into Wednesday's contest looking for a big change in momentum after dropping their third straight game on Monday. They fell just short of Tuslaw by a score of 1-0. The game was a 0-0 toss-up at halftime, but the Falcons couldn't quite close it out.
Meanwhile, Northwest lost 7-1 to Orrville on Monday. The Indians were in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at 3-0.
Fairless' defeat dropped their record down to 1-9-1. As for Northwest, they have been struggling recently as they've lost three of their last four matches, which put a noticeable dent in their 5-5 record this season.
